To understand the obsession, one must understand the file format. An file (iOS App Store Package) is essentially a compressed archive, akin to a .zip file, containing the binary code, resources, and metadata of an iOS application. Proponents argue that IPA archives function as digital museums. Many apps from the iOS 7 era have been pulled from the App Store or updated to the point of being unrecognizable. Without archives, this slice of software history would be lost entirely. In 2018, the Library of Congress granted exemptions to the DMCA for the preservation of abandoned video games, a precedent preservationists argue should apply to mobile software.
